About C. McConaghy
C. McConaghy is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ering, Atomic and Molecular Physics, and Optics, Computer Networks and Communications and Instrumentation, having authored 31 papers that have together received 498 indexed citations. Recurring topics across this work include Advanced MEMS and NEMS Technologies (7 papers), Microfluidic and Bio-sensing Technologies (5 papers), Photonic and Optical Devices (5 papers), Electrowetting and Microfluidic Technologies (4 papers), CCD and CMOS Imaging Sensors (4 papers), Force Microscopy Techniques and Applications (3 papers), Electrohydrodynamics and Fluid Dynamics (3 papers) and Semiconductor Lasers and Optical Devices (3 papers). The work is most often cited by research in Electrical and Electronic Engineering (377 citations), Biomedical Engineering (245 citations), Bioengineering (25 citations), Atomic and Molecular Physics, and Optics (120 citations) and Molecular Medicine (12 citations). C. McConaghy has collaborated with scholars based in United States and Netherlands. Frequent co-authors include L. W. Coleman, Peter R. C. Gascoyne, Jody V. Vykoukal, K.W. Current, T. J. Anderson, Daynene Vykoukal, Jon A. Schwartz, Frederick F. Becker, Gary E. Sommargren and Peter A Krulevitch. Their work appears in journals such as Biomedical Microdevices, Lab on a Chip, Applied Physics Letters, Review of Scientific Instruments and IEEE Sensors Journal.
